Abstract

Registered banded wrapper, cigarettes using that wrapper paper, and methods of making cigarettes with that banded paper result in banded regions of cigarette paper which begin at substantially the same location on each cigarette. With the banded region positioned at a preferred predetermined distance from the end of the cigarette, cigarettes made with such paper exhibit a consistent and improved ignition propensity compared with random or quasi-randomly positioned banded regions.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A registrable wrapper for a smoking article having a nominal length, comprising:
 a base web having a longitudinal direction and a transverse direction, and a plurality of ignition-propensity-modulating structures
 substantially uniformly spaced in the longitudinal direction of the base web, 
 extending in the transverse direction of the base web, and 
 having a nominal width measured in the longitudinal direction of the base web, 
   where the pitch between adjacent ignition-propensity-modulating structures in the longitudinal direction of the base web is selected as the nominal length divided by an integer.   
     
     
         2 . The registrable wrapper of  claim 1  wherein the ignition-propensity-modulating structures are substantially continuous bands extending across the width of the base web. 
     
     
         3 . The registrable wrapper of  claim 2 , wherein the integer is 1. 
     
     
         4 . The registrable wrapper of  claim 2 , wherein the integer is 2. 
     
     
         5 . The registrable wrapper of  claim 2 , wherein the integer is 3. 
     
     
         6 . The registrable wrapper of  claim 2 , wherein the integer is 4. 
     
     
         7 . An assembly from which one or more smoking articles each having a nominal length may be severed comprising:
 a tobacco rod including a quantity of tobacco surrounded by a wrapper, the tobacco rod having a longitudinal direction and a rod length which is an integral multiple of the nominal length;   the wrapper including a plurality of ignition-propensity-modulating structures
 substantially uniformly spaced in the longitudinal direction of the tobacco rod, 
 extending substantially around the tobacco rod, and 
 having a nominal width measured in the longitudinal direction of the tobacco rod, 
   where the pitch between adjacent ignition-propensity-modulating structures in the longitudinal direction of the tobacco rod is selected as the nominal length divided by an integer.   
     
     
         8 . The assembly of  claim 7  wherein the tobacco rod has an end, and the center of the ignition-propensity-modulating structure most closely adjacent to the end is spaced from the end by ½ the pitch between adjacent ignition-propensity-modulating structures. 
     
     
         9 . The assembly of  claim 8  wherein the rod length is twice the nominal length. 
     
     
         10 . The assembly of  claim 8  wherein the rod length is four times the nominal length. 
     
     
         11 . The assembly of  claim 8  wherein the integer is 1. 
     
     
         12 . The assembly of  claim 8  wherein the integer is 2. 
     
     
         13 . The assembly of  claim 8  wherein the integer is 3. 
     
     
         14 . The assembly of  claim 8  wherein the integer is 4. 
     
     
         15 . The assembly of  claim 8  wherein the ignition-propensity-modulating structure has a width in the range of about 5 to about 7 mm. 
     
     
         16 . The assembly of  claim 8  wherein the nominal length lies in the range of about 50 to about 100 mm. 
     
     
         17 . The assembly of  claim 8  wherein the ignition-propensity-modulating structure is applied as a band of aqueous starch composition. 
     
     
         18 . A smoking article comprising:
 a tobacco rod including a quantity of tobacco having a longitudinal direction and a rod length; and   a wrapper surrounding the tobacco and including a plurality of ignition-propensity-modulating structures
 substantially uniformly spaced in the longitudinal direction of the tobacco rod, 
 extending substantially around the tobacco rod, and 
 having a nominal width measured in the longitudinal direction of the tobacco rod, 
   where the pitch between adjacent ignition-propensity-modulating structures in the longitudinal direction of the tobacco rod is selected as the rod length divided by an integer greater than 1.   
     
     
         19 . The smoking article of  claim 18  wherein the ignition-propensity-modulating structures comprise at least one band printed from an aqueous starch material. 
     
     
         20 . The smoking article of  claim 18  wherein the tobacco rod has an end, and the center of the ignition-propensity-modulating structure most closely adjacent to the end is spaced from the end by ½ the pitch between adjacent ignition-propensity-modulating structures. 
     
     
         21 . The smoking article of  claim 18  wherein the ignition-propensity-modulating structure has a width in the range of about 5 to about 7 mm. 
     
     
         22 . The smoking article of  claim 17  further including a filter attached to one end of the tobacco rod. 
     
     
         23 . The smoking article of  claim 18  wherein the nominal length lies in the range of about 50 to about 100 mm. 
     
     
         24 . A method of enhancing ignition propensity performance of smoking articles for which the tobacco rod has a nominal length comprising:
 determining the predetermined pitch for banded regions as the nominal length divided by an integer, x;   establishing banded regions along a tobacco rod with the predetermined pitch;   severing the tobacco rod at the midpoint between two adjacent banded regions in a rod maker to create a tobacco rod in which x banded regions occur for each nominal length of the tobacco rod; and   cutting the tobacco rod into lengths to establish a tobacco rod portion with the center of a first one of said banded regions spaced from a lit end of said tobacco rod portion by a distance corresponding to ½ the predetermined pitch.
